My Buying Guides on Gym Gloves For Women
Why I Use Gym Gloves
When I started lifting and doing more intense workouts, I quickly realized that gym gloves made a big difference for me. They helped me protect my palms from calluses, gave me a better grip on weights, and made my hands feel more comfortable during longer sessions. For me, the right pair of gloves also adds confidence because I can focus more on my workout and less on discomfort.
What I Look For in Fit and Comfort
Fit is the first thing I pay attention to when buying gym gloves. I want them snug, but not too tight. If they are loose, they slip during exercises, and if they are too tight, they feel restrictive and uncomfortable. I also prefer gloves with breathable material so my hands do not get too sweaty. Soft padding in the right places matters to me too, especially around the palm area.
Material Quality Matters
In my experience, the material makes a huge difference in how long the gloves last. I usually look for gloves made with durable leather, synthetic leather, or strong mesh fabric. These materials hold up well during regular training. I also like gloves with moisture-wicking fabric because they help keep my hands dry and reduce odor over time.
Grip and Palm Protection
A strong grip is one of the main reasons I wear gym gloves. I check whether the gloves have anti-slip padding or silicone grip on the palms and fingers. This helps me hold dumbbells, barbells, and machines more securely. At the same time, I want enough padding to protect my palms without making the gloves feel bulky.
Wrist Support
For me, wrist support is important when I do heavier lifts. Some gym gloves come with adjustable wrist straps, and I find those especially useful. They give me extra stability and make me feel safer during exercises like deadlifts, bench presses, and rows. If I am doing lighter workouts, I may choose gloves with less wrist support for more flexibility.
Breathability and Sweat Control
I always check how breathable a pair of gloves is before buying. My hands tend to sweat during workouts, so I prefer gloves with mesh panels or ventilation holes. This keeps my hands cooler and helps prevent slipping. Breathable gloves also feel fresher after repeated use.
Style and Design
I like gym gloves that look good as well as perform well. Since women’s gloves often come in different colors and designs, I usually choose a style that matches my workout gear. While appearance is not the most important factor, I do appreciate a pair that feels both functional and stylish.
Easy to Clean
Cleaning is another thing I consider. Since gym gloves absorb sweat, I want a pair that is easy to wash or wipe down. In my experience, gloves that dry quickly are much more convenient because I can use them again sooner without worrying about odor or moisture buildup.
Choosing the Right Gloves for My Workout
I choose different gloves depending on the type of training I do. For weightlifting, I prefer gloves with strong grip and wrist support. For general gym workouts or cardio-based training, I like lighter gloves that feel flexible and breathable. Thinking about my workout style helps me pick the most suitable pair.
